Una, March 21- Deputy Commissioner Jatin Lal on Friday visited the ancient Peer Gauns temple located in Panchayat Balh Khalsa of Kutlehar assembly constituency. During this, he took stock of the construction and development works being done for the beautification of Peer Gauns temple and to provide better facilities to the devotees.
The Deputy Commissioner gave directions to the concerned officers to complete the construction works quickly and in a quality manner. He also interacted with the members of the temple management committee and assured all possible cooperation from the administration to provide better facilities to the devotees.
The Deputy Commissioner said that the district administration is fully committed to the preservation of religious and cultural heritage so that historical and religious places can be preserved and made more attractive.
On this occasion, Tehsildar Bangana Amit Sharma, Sevadar Mahendra Singh, Ranjit Singh, Lakhwinder Singh and Rajiv Kumar, among others, were present.
